python
1y = sympy.Symbol('y') 2 3ans = sympy.solve(sympy.sin(y) - sympy.sin(y - mouseh) - hm)
という計算をしたいのですが、値が出ません。
mousehを予め、y=0のときのhmの値となるように設定していて、hmを変化させたときのyを計算したいです。
mouseh, hmを定数にしても(mouseh=0.4, hm=0.609375)変わりませんでした。
python
1y = sympy.Symbol('y') 2z = sympy.Symbol('z') 3 4exp1 = sympy.sin(y) - sympy.sin(z) - hm # 縮むほうで計算 5exp2 = y - mouseh -z 6ans = sympy.solve([exp1,exp2])
としても変わりませんでした。
追記、
python
1ansy = sympy.solve(((1 - sympy.sin(x)) / (sympy.sin(x) + sympy.cos(x))) - ratio)
という式は計算できていて、(ratioは0.6~0.7程度です)式の書き方がおかしいのかと思ったんですが、、、
mouseh、hm はなんでしょうか?
コピペして動くコードを質問欄に記載してください。

回答1件
あなたの回答
tips
プレビュー